blob: 93c260f29c2e51a455fb054edd5bb2bee002b04e (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
|
---
title: Gonk
slug: Glossaire/Gonk
tags:
- Boot2Gecko
- Firefox OS
- Glossaire
- Gonk
- Infrastructure
- Introduction
translation_of: Glossary/Gonk
---
<p>Gonk est le système d'exploitation bas-niveau de {{glossary("Firefox OS")}} et consiste en un noyau Linux (basé sur <a class="external external-icon" href="http://source.android.com/">Android Open Source Project</a> (AOSP)) et une couche d'abstraction matérielle en espace utilisateur (hardware abstraction layer, ou HAL).</p>
<p>Le noyau et plusieurs des bibliothèques en espace utilisateur sont des projets open source usuels : Linux, libusb, bluez, et ainsi de suite. D'autres éléments de la HAL sont communs avec AOSP : GPS, caméra et autres. Gonk peut être considéré comme une distribution Linux très simple.</p>
<p>Gonk est une <strong>cible</strong> de {{glossary("Gecko")}} (tout comme Gecko a été porté sur OS X, Windows et Android). Comme Firefox OS dispose d'un contrôle total sur Gonk, il est possible d'offrir à Gecko des interfaces qui ne sont pas accessibles sur d'autres systèmes d'exploitation, comme par exemple toute la pile de téléphonie et l'affichage frame buffer.</p>
<h2 id="Pour_en_savoir_plus">Pour en savoir plus</h2>
<p><a href="https://developer.mozilla.org/fr/docs/Archive/B2G_OS/Platform/Gonk">Page sur Gonk dans la zone Firefox OS</a></p>
|